How to Use Workplace Informational Interviews Strategically

from The Office Politics Podcast with Fexingo: Workplace Dynamics, Influence, and Getting Things Done · host Fexingo

Episode 48 of The Office Politics Podcast dives into the subtle art of the informational interview as a career lever. Lucas and Luna break down why this underused tool can shift workplace power dynamics — if done right. They discuss how timing, framing, and follow-up separate a productive conversation from a time-waster. Using a real example from a mid-level marketing manager who landed a mentorship and a promotion after a single thirty-minute coffee chat, the hosts walk through the three-phase process: preparation that signals competence, questions that reveal institutional knowledge, and a close that converts insight into advocacy. They also cover common pitfalls: asking for advice you could Google, treating the meeting as a therapy session, and forgetting to pay it forward.
